Как да добавите парола към Word документ с помощта на Java

В тази статия е дадено описание на как да добавите парола към Word документ с помощта на Java. Той съдържа цялата информация за конфигурацията на средата за разработка, последователност от стъпки за написване на програма и изпълним примерен код, който демонстрира функцията за защита на документ на Word с помощта на Java. Могат да се използват различни опции и свойства, докато защитавате документа и го записвате във всеки от поддържаните формати като DOC, DOCX и др.

Стъпки за заключване на Word документ с помощта на Java

  1. Създайте среда за използване на Aspose.Words от хранилището за защита на документ на Word
  2. Създайте или заредете файл на Word, като използвате обекта на клас Document
  3. Приложете защитата на документа, като извикате метода protect() заедно с вида на защитата и паролата
  4. Запазете защитения Word файл в желания формат, поддържан от MS Word

Тези стъпки обясняват как да защитите Word файл с парола с помощта на Java, като първо напътствате за организиране на средата за разработка и след това споделяте поетапния подход за изпълнение на задачата. Въвеждат се всички необходими класове и методи, които са необходими за прилагане на парола върху файла на Word, за да се забрани редактирането или други видове защита. След като се приложи желаната защита, изходният файл на Word може да бъде записан на диска заедно с опцията за използване на обекта от клас SaveOptions, който позволява много функции, преди да запазите документа.

Код за защита с парола на Word документ с помощта на Java

Ако искате Word файл, заключен за редактиране с помощта на Java, този код може да се използва без писане на друг код. Можете да приложите различен тип защита, като тук се прилага защита САМО READ_ONLY, която забранява редактирането на документа, но можете да приложите други защити като ALLOW_ONLY_COMMENTS за модифициране на коментарите и ALLOW_ONLY_REVISIONS за добавяне на знаци за редакция в документа.

Този урок ни напътства да направим файла на Word само за четене с помощта на Java. Ако искате да научите процеса на четене на документ на Word, вижте статията на как да чета документ на Word в Java.

 Български